Swift Code details for MSHQQAQAXXX
Main Office: 8-char BIC or XXX branch code
The Swift Code MSHQQAQAXXX is assigned to MASHREQ BANK located in C-RING ROAD, OPPOSITE GULF TIMES, DOHA, Qatar.
This SWIFT/BIC code is used for international wire transfers and follows the standard format for secure cross-border payments. Branch details include postal code -, status: Active. This Swift Code MSHQQAQAXXX has been validated and confirmed as active for banking transactions.
